Customer Service Clerk Job In Canada    

Customer service clerk primarily perform different tasks like customer handling, cashier duties, gives information, and answering questions on the behalf of the company. There are different companies and institutions which hire customer service clerk. The customer service clerk performs in insurance, retail, telecommunications, utility, and service providing companies. The selected employee will be responsible for resolving customer’s complaints. Moreover, he notes and record requests of clients and forward to relevant department. Customer service clerk answer the questions of the customers and provide relevant information. He makes sure all deliveries of the products to customers in a timely manner. He provides full details of the products of the company or provided services. The customer service clerk also collects the installments and keeps record.
